Google offers a set of filters called the Google Search options that can be used by users to refine their search. This was introduced by Google few months ago in May for web search and image search. It was introduced in order to increase the search speed. Google has now added more filters to the web search in order to make it even more sophisticated and for giving a better search experience for the users. Google Search options have been appended with nine new search options. The filters that have been introduced include more shopping sites, past hour, fewer shopping sites, specific date range, books, visited pages, not yet visited, blogs and news.
By clicking on the ‘show options’ link on top of the Google search results page, users would be able to see the filters listed on the left side of the search results page. These options would be very useful for users as with these options they would be able to refine their search like just searching the information they need like videos and more. The product manager in search, Mr. Nandu Janakiram has said that Google is introducing new options in search that be used by Google users to find the last one hour results posted in Google News and Google Books. Users would even be able to see more less results from the stores depending on what they need.
Though it was already possible for users to make their searches within Google Books and Google News, Google feels that this new update in the Google Search Options that has included several filters would help users in making their search without having to leave the main search results page. Mr. Nandu Janakiram has said that even when the user clicks on the ‘News’ filter page, the look and feel of the search page would not change.
One more advantage of this is that Google would now be able to sell different types of ads on the same the same results page. Mr. Nandu Janakiram has said that the filters that the users choose to can be “a potentially helpful signal about user intent, so it does change the way ads appear,”. It is not sure on whether different sets of ads would be used by Google but it can be said that users would now be able to remove ads that are irrelevant in some search pages.
The filters that Google has updated now would be available for all Google visitors. However, if the user has a Google account then he or she would also bee able to refine results pages that they have already visited. This would be very useful for users as they would not have to go through the entire search again as they would easily be able to trace out the website that they have already visited.
